Improvement Plan Process for Failure Mode and Effects Analysis (FMEA) Table, Thesis of Marketing Research

A table with 4 steps for an improvement plan process using Failure Mode and Effects Analysis (FMEA) to identify potential failures and their impact on patient care. Each step includes a failure mode, likelihood of occurrence, likelihood of detection, severity, and risk priority number. The example provided is on-call staff forgetting to clock in when arriving to the unit. likely related to healthcare management and quality improvement.
